A Collection of Anger … WitrynaJournaling: Fun Impulse Control Activity for Teens. Encourage your teen to express their thoughts and emotions through journaling. Writing down feelings can help them reflect on their actions and identify patterns of impulsive behavior. Witryna1 maj 2024 · Adjust your goals according to your child’s temperament, track record and age. Remove structure and supervision “scaffolding” as your child demonstrates self-government. Choose organized activities that stretch your child’s capacities for self-control. Include R & R in your family’s routines. Witrynaworksheet. Psychological flexibility is the capacity to adapt to difficult experiences while remaining true to one’s values.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) focuses heavily on this skill due to its many benefits. These include better resilience, emotional tolerance, and overall well-being.

WitrynaExploring emotions is an important part of therapy. However, many people have a hard time identifying and naming their feelings. Complex emotions are often hidden behind catch-all terms such as “I feel good” or “I feel bad.”. The Basic Emotions handout lists four basic emotions that are commonly discussed in therapy—happiness, sadness ... Witryna25 paź 2024 · It's normal for young children to be physically impulsive. Hitting, jumping off furniture, or running in the grocery store are common impulse control problems. By the tween and teen years, most kids have gained control over their physical impulses but they may still be verbally impulsive.
